Butternut Squash Lasagna

Prep Time: 30 mins
Cook Time: 1 hrs
Total Time: 1 hrs 30 mins
Cuisine: Italian
Serves: 8 servings

Ingredients

  1. 2 cups butternut squash, cubed
  2. 9 lasagna noodles
  3. 2 cups ricotta cheese
  4. 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  5. 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  6. 2 cups marinara sauce
  7.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and prepare a 9x13 inch baking dish by lightly greasing it with olive oil.
  2. Roast the butternut squash cubes on a baking sheet. Toss with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Spread evenly and roast for 25-30 minutes until tender and lightly caramelized, stirring once halfway through.
  3. Cook lasagna noodles in a large pot of salted boiling water according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and rinse with cold water to prevent sticking.
  4. In a mixing bowl, combine ricotta cheese with roasted butternut squash, mashing some squash pieces to create a creamy texture. Season with salt, pepper, and a pinch of nutmeg if desired.
  5. Begin layering the lasagna: Spread a thin layer of marinara sauce on the bottom of the baking dish to prevent sticking.
  6. Layer lasagna noodles to cover the bottom of the dish, slightly overlapping. Spread a thick layer of the butternut squash-ricotta mixture over the noodles.
  7. S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the ricotta layer. Add another layer of marinara sauce.
  8. Repeat the layering process two more times, ending with a top layer of noodles covered with marinara sauce and a generous sprinkle of mozzarella and Parmesan cheese.
  9.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il, ensuring it doesn't touch the cheese. Bake for 40 minutes.
  10. Remove foil and bake for an additional 15-20 minutes until the top is golden brown and cheese is bubbly.
  11. Remove from oven and let the lasagna rest for 15 minutes before serving. This allows the layers to set and makes cutting easier.
  12. Garnish with fresh basil or parsley if desired, and serve hot.

Tips

  1. Roasting is Key: Take your time roasting the butternut squash. The caramelization adds depth of flavor and brings out the natural sweetness of the squash.
  2. Prevent Soggy Layers: Pat your cooked lasagna noodles dry and let them cool slightly before layering to prevent excess moisture.
  3. Cheese Matters: Use freshly grated cheese for the best melting and flavor. Pre-shredded cheese often contains anti-caking agents that can affect texture.
  4. Resting Time is Crucial: Always let the lasagna rest for 15 minutes after baking. This helps the layers set and makes cutting and serving much easier.
  5. Make Ahead Friendly: This lasagna can be prepared in advance and refrigerated. Just add 10-15 minutes to the baking time if cooking from cold.
  6. Customize Your Spices: Add a pinch of nutmeg or dried thyme to the ricotta mixture for an extra flavor dimension.
